Abstract:
“Profitability is an appropriate indicator to measure the performance of a bank. profitability assessment useful to determine the ability of companies in creating profit from capital used. This study aims to determine the effect of Capital Structure and Liquidity to Profitability of Bank Companies in Indonesia Stock Exchange. The population used in this study are all banking companies list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ange period 2013-2016. Sampling technique used is purposive sampling, based on sample determination criteria then the samples obtained are 33 banking companies list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ange period 2013-2016. Based on the results of the analysis found that the debt ratio has a negative significant effect to the return on equity of the Bank companies in the Indonesia Stock Exchange, debt to equity ratio have a positive significant effect to the return on equity of the bank companies in Indonesia Stock Exchange, loan to deposit ratio positive significant to return on equity a bank company on the Indonesia Stock Exchange.”
